The Mechanics of the Bounce: How Does it Work?
The heart of plinko lies in the seemingly chaotic bounce of the puck as it navigates the peg-filled board. The path each puck takes is dictated by a complex interplay of physics, including gravity, friction, and the angle of impact with each peg. Even the slightest variation in the initial drop or the puck’s trajectory can lead to drastically different outcomes. This inherent unpredictability is what makes plinko so appealing – and why it’s notoriously difficult to predict where a puck will ultimately land.
While true randomness is impossible to achieve in any physical system, good plinko board designs aim to approximate it. The even spacing of pegs, the consistent material of the puck, and a level playing surface all contribute to a reasonably fair and unpredictable outcome. Probability and Randomness in Plinko
The concept of randomness is central to the enjoyment of plinko. Each bounce of the puck represents an uncertain event, influenced by a multitude of factors. However, over a large number of trials, a predictable pattern emerges. This principle is known as the Law of Large Numbers, which states that the average result of repeating an experiment many times will converge toward the expected value.
In the context of plinko, this means that if you were to drop a large number of pucks onto the board, the distribution of the pucks among the prize slots would approximate the board’s underlying probability distribution. While individual outcomes remain unpredictable, the overall trend is predictable and consistent. It is this balance between randomness and predictability that makes plinko a fascinating, interesting game.
